A temporary injunction grants urgent, immediate relief to preserve the current status quo during an ongoing trial. A permanent injunction is awarded in the final court decree to permanently stop an illegal act or interference.
While contested civil trials can take time, the strategic filing of summary suits and urgent applications for interim relief can often secure effective, enforceable results within just a few months.
It is a targeted legal action where the court forces a defaulting party to physically fulfill their contractual promise—such as executing a property sale deed—rather than simply paying financial damages.
A civil suit is filed in the local court having jurisdiction over where the defendant resides, where the disputed property is located, or where the actual contract breach occurred.
